Каким образом программные продукты осуществляют контроль соответствия
Нынешняя создание ПО немыслима без комплексной структуры контроля стандартов. Каждый день огромное количество клиентов работают с разнообразными программами, веб-сервисами и программными разработками, требуя от них стабильной функциональности, секьюрности и соответствия заявленному функционалу. Процесс обеспечения качества программных продуктов составляет собой многоступенчатую систему проверок, проверки и контроля, которая поддерживает продукт на каждом фазах его развития.
Что точно определяют надежностью в технических разработках
Качество софта ап икс характеризуется множеством характеристик, которые в целом создают клиентский опыт и технологическую надежность решения. Функциональность остается главным параметром – программа обязана осуществлять все заявленные опции в согласии с системными спецификациями и надеждами юзеров.
Надежность программного разработки выражается в его способности функционировать без сбоев в различных условиях эксплуатации. Это охватывает устойчивость к неожиданным входным данным, правильную работу ошибочных условий и возможность возобновляться после временных сбоев. Эффективность определяет темп реализации действий, длительность реакции программы на клиентские операции и результативность задействования компьютерных мощностей.
Комфорт использования показывает, насколько доступным и приятным оказывается взаимодействие с приложением для конечных клиентов. Здесь включаются эргономичность взаимодействия ап икс, логичность перемещения, открытость для граждан с особыми потребностями и всеобщая доступность освоения функционала.
Сопровождаемость технического кода сказывается на возможность его последующего совершенствования и поддержки. Грамотно созданный программа обязан быть читаемым, структурированным, детально оформленным и структурированным таким образом, чтобы другие программисты были способны легко в нем разобраться и добавить необходимые изменения.
Каким образом контролируют, что каждое действует по спецификациям
Проверка соблюдения технического решения спецификациям инициируется с детального анализа ТЗ и рабочих требований. Команда тестирования разрабатывает детальные проверки, которые покрывают все указанные в материалах сценарии применения приложения up x. Каждый сценарий включает четкие шаги для повторения, предполагаемые итоги и параметры успешного прохождения контроля.
Схема отслеживаемости требований помогает проверить, что всякое спецификация охвачено релевантными испытаниями, а всякий испытание ассоциирован с специфическим требованием. Это позволяет исключить случаев, когда важная функциональность остается нетестированной или когда тратится время на тестирование отсутствующих условий.
Заключительное тестирование выполняется с привлечением клиентов или делегатов бизнес-подразделений, которые максимально полно знают, как программа обязана функционировать в практических обстоятельствах. Они проверяют не только технологическую корректность выполнения, но и совместимость рабочим процедурам и потребительским предположениям.
Возвратное тестирование обеспечивает, что новые модификации в системе не нарушили предварительно работавший возможности. После любого обновления или исправления ошибок запускается группа тестов, тестирующих основные возможности программы.
Почему контроль начинается еще до создания скрипта
Актуальный метод к обеспечению надежности предполагает энергичное участие профессионалов по проверке на начальных фазах программы:
- Анализ условий позволяет обнаружить ошибки, несоответствия и пробелы в технических спецификациях до начала разработки.
- Проектирование тестовых случаев содействует качественнее осмыслить планируемое поведение программы и детализировать детали выполнения.
- Подготовка проверочных данных и испытательной структуры сберегает ресурс на дальнейших этапах.
- Составление методологии тестирования устанавливает необходимые ресурсы и периоды для надежной проверки.
- Формирование автоматизированных проверок может стартовать одновременно с созданием основного скрипта.
Такой метод, известный как “сдвиг влево” в контроле, заметно сокращает расходы устранения багов, потому что их обнаружение и исправление на ранних фазах предполагает минимальных расходов времени и средств. Помимо этого, преждевременное вовлечение специалистов в ход способствует формированию общего восприятия задачи у полной коллектива разработки ап икс официальный сайт.
Которые разновидности контроля используют: вручную и автоматически
Ручное испытание остается уникальным способом для проверки клиентского опыта, исследовательского тестирования и контроля комплексных рабочих ситуаций. Эксперты выполняют роль финальных клиентов, взаимодействуя с приложением через визуальный интерфейс и анализируя комфорт применения, разумность работы и соответствие надеждам.
Исследовательское испытание позволяет найти внезапные дефекты и проблемы, которые не были предусмотрены в формальных тест-кейсах. Квалифицированные эксперты задействуют свое осознание направления и техническую чутье для выявления потенциальных слабых мест в приложении.
Автоматизированное испытание эффективно для контроля повторяющихся сценариев, возвратного проверки и анализа значительных количеств информации. Программные испытания могут исполняться круглосуточно, не требуют присутствия человека и гарантируют устойчивые выводы контроля.
Единичное проверка проверяет отдельные компоненты программы up x в изоляции от прочей программы. Программисты формируют испытания для своего программирования, которые запускаются при всяком изменении и помогают быстро выявлять сложности на уровне индивидуальных функций или классов.
Интеграционное испытание фокусируется на проверке контакта между различными элементами и блоками системы. Оно содействует обнаружить неполадки в взаимодействиях, пересылке материалов между компонентами и всеобщей построении решения.
Какими методами находят дефекты на отличающихся стадиях разработки
На этапе планирования и создания дефекты обнаруживаются через ревью технических спецификаций, изучение архитектурных решений и моделирование потребительских ситуаций. Специалисты различных специализаций изучают материалы, выявляют потенциальные неполадки и рекомендуют усовершенствования до старта интенсивной программирования.
Во момент написания скрипта разработчики задействуют фиксированный изучение скрипта, который программно проверяет приложение ап икс официальный сайт на совместимость правилам программирования, потенциальные проблемы защиты и обычные ошибки разработки. Актуальные объединенные платформы разработки включают инструменты, которые выделяют неполадки непосредственно в ходе разработки кода.
Код-ревью представляет собой процедуру взаимной анализа программы кодерами. Сотрудники исследуют разработанный программу с позиции логики деятельности, совместимости стандартам команды, возможных неполадок эффективности и возможностей для улучшения. Этот ход не только содействует выявить баги, но и помогает передаче знаниями в коллективе.
Активное испытание выполняется на действующей программе и содержит многочисленные разновидности операционного и дополнительного проверки. Эксперты стартуют систему с различными входными данными, контролируют работу в крайних ситуациях и изучают выводы исполнения.
Почему важно контролировать безопасность и охрану материалов
Безопасность цифровых продуктов up x оказывается жизненно необходимым элементом надежности в эпоху компьютеризации и увеличивающихся интернет-рисков. Нарушения секьюрности могут повлечь не только к денежным убыткам, но и к значительному урону престижу компании, потере доверия покупателей и правовым последствиям.
Проверка защищенности содержит контроль аутентификации и разрешения клиентов, охраны от основных разновидностей нападений, подобно внедрения запросов, XSS и фальсификация междоменных обращений. Эксперты по безопасности изучают структуру системы с позиции потенциальных угроз и контролируют результативность реализованных охранных систем.
Защита индивидуальных информации нуждается особого сосредоточенности в связи с усилением законодательства в области секретности. Приложения призваны корректно управлять, содержать и транспортировать конфиденциальную данные, предоставлять возможность ликвидации данных по требованию клиентов и выполнять основы минимизации сбора данных.
Криптографическая защита информации ап икс тестируется на предмет использования актуальных способов кодирования, корректной воплощения протоколов защиты и корректного регулирования паролями. Проблемные зоны в криптографии могут превратить всю систему защиты малорезультативной.
Каким образом контролируют темп, нагрузку и надежность
Быстродействие ПО контролируется через комплекс нагрузочных тестов, которые имитируют разнообразные сценарии эксплуатации программы в практических условиях. Загрузочное проверка определяет, как программа работает при предполагаемом объеме юзеров и действий.
Предельное испытание содействует обнаружить точку отказа приложения, постепенно повышая нагрузку до предельных значений. Это позволяет осмыслить лимиты возможностей программы и проверить, как правильно она ухудшается при избыточном напряжении.
Проверка устойчивости содержит долгосрочные контроль деятельности приложения ап икс официальный сайт под непрерывной напряжением для обнаружения расхода данных, планомерного уменьшения производительности и других неполадок, которые демонстрируются только при продолжительной работе.
Наблюдение быстродействия во период контроля охватывает контроль применения процессора, памяти, хранилища и интернет возможностей. Эти параметры способствуют найти узкие места в архитектуре и оптимизировать быстродействие системы.
Что предпринимают, если дефект обнаружена перед релизом
Выявление бага перед выпуском решения запускает процедуру анализа серьезности сложности и формирования выбора о дальнейших действиях. Серьезные баги, которые могут повлечь к лишению данных, взлому секьюрности или тотальной неработоспособности системы, требуют немедленного исправления.
Процедура контроля ошибками содержит подробное оформление выявленной проблемы с указанием шагов для воспроизведения, окружения, в при которых выражается дефект, и планируемого функционирования приложения. Группа программирования анализирует ошибку, выявляет основание и планирует коррекцию.
Ранжирование устранений основывается на эффекте бага на юзеров ап икс, периодичности ее выражения и трудности ликвидации. Отдельные малые проблемы могут быть перенаправлены до последующего запуска, если их устранение требует существенных изменений в скрипте.
После устранения бага выполняется подтверждающее проверка, которое доказывает, что неполадка устранена, а также возвратное испытание для тестирования того, что устранение не вызвало к образованию дополнительных дефектов в других частях программы.